diff --git a/src/yaml/processor_odom_3D_yaml.cpp b/src/yaml/processor_odom_3D_yaml.cpp
index c8e597c01d7f69d9f06c3bbd62f6ba85dfb5fbb6..6b6f53a64d655f77127ddf398add56246b2a55ed 100644
--- a/src/yaml/processor_odom_3D_yaml.cpp
+++ b/src/yaml/processor_odom_3D_yaml.cpp
@@ -28,7 +28,9 @@ static ProcessorParamsBasePtr createProcessorOdom3DParams(const std::string & _f
     {
         ProcessorParamsOdom3DPtr params = std::make_shared<ProcessorParamsOdom3D>();
 
-        params->time_tolerance      = config["time_tolerance"]      .as<Scalar>();
+        params->voting_active       = config["voting_active"]      .as<bool>();
+        params->voting_aux_active   = config["voting_aux_active"]  .as<bool>();
+        params->time_tolerance      = config["time_tolerance"]     .as<Scalar>();
         params->max_time_span       = config["max_time_span"]      .as<Scalar>();
         params->max_buff_length     = config["max_buff_length"]    .as<SizeEigen  >();
         params->dist_traveled       = config["dist_traveled"]      .as<Scalar>();